Jack Smith Received a ‘Gift’ of $140,000 in Pro Bono Legal Services from High-Powered DC Firm Before He Resigned |

Former Special Counsel Jack Smith recently received $140,000 in pro bono legal services from the prestigious DC firm Covington and Burling. This gift was disclosed in Jack Smith’s financial records, as reported by Politico. The reason for this generous offering is not immediately clear, but it is speculated that Jack Smith’s prosecutors sought legal advice from top-tier law firms in anticipation of the incoming Trump administration.

Reports suggest that there is growing concern among government officials and investigators who fear potential retaliation from the Trump administration. A former senior White House official revealed that there is intense worry about possible prosecutions under the new administration. This has prompted several prominent white-collar lawyers in Washington to receive inquiries from individuals, including Jack Smith’s investigators, who are anxious about being targeted.

In a separate development, Rolling Stone highlighted the fears of Jack Smith’s prosecutors regarding financial instability and the need to safeguard their family’s assets. The uncertainty surrounding potential legal actions has created a sense of urgency among those involved in the investigation.

Former President Donald Trump has been vocal in his criticism of Jack Smith, calling for his imprisonment. Trump accused Jack Smith and his team of weaponizing the Department of Justice and targeting him unfairly. He raised questions about past incidents involving prominent figures like Hillary Clinton and Bill Clinton, questioning why they were not held accountable for their actions.

While Trump’s Department of Justice has not initiated a criminal probe into Jack Smith, US Attorney General Pam Bondi has directed the formation of a group to review the cases brought against Trump by Jack Smith. The review will focus on the alleged weaponization of the Special Counsel’s office and the excessive spending on targeting the former president.

In response to these developments, Trump’s Justice Department took decisive action by dismissing more than a dozen officials who were involved in Jack Smith’s team. This purge signals a shift in priorities within the department and a clear message that past actions will be scrutinized and rectified.

Overall, the ongoing scrutiny of Jack Smith’s investigation and the subsequent fallout underscore the contentious nature of legal proceedings in the political arena. The dynamics between law enforcement agencies and political figures continue to shape the landscape of justice and accountability in the United States.
